Sea level muon energy spectra at large zenith angles have been derived from the latest JACEE primary spectrum using the Fermilab Single-Arm Spectrometer data on charged-meson production. The role of increasing total cross-section on the final result for the energy spectra has been investigated here with special emphasis. The inclusion of the rising total cross-section at cosmic range of energies, it is seen, has come into much use in explaining the observed data at very high energies.
